TSR Storm Alert - Tropical Storm NARELLE

SW Pacific: Storm Alert issued at 25 Mar, 2026 0:00 GMT

Tropical Storm NARELLE is currently located near 17.4 S 120.0 E with maximum 1-min sustained winds of 55kts (63 mph). NARELLE is forecast to affect land to the following likelihood(s) at the given lead time(s):


Yellow Alert Country(s) or Province(s)
    Australia
        probability for CAT 1 or above is 20% in about 36 hours
        probability for TS is 90% in about 36 hours
Yellow Alert City(s) and Town(s)
    Onslow (21.7 S, 115.0 E)
        probability for CAT 1 or above is 15% in about 36 hours
        probability for TS is 80% in about 36 hours
    Exmouth (21.9 S, 114.2 E)
        probability for CAT 1 or above is 20% in about 48 hours
        probability for TS is 80% in about 48 hours
    Roebourne (20.8 S, 117.2 E)
        probability for TS is 75% in about 24 hours
    Cardabia (23.0 S, 113.9 E)
        probability for CAT 1 or above is 15% in about 48 hours
        probability for TS is 70% in about 48 hours
    Pannawonica (21.8 S, 116.3 E)
        probability for TS is 60% in about 36 hours
    Port Hedland (20.4 S, 118.6 E)
        probability for TS is 55% in about 24 hours
    Carnarvon (24.9 S, 113.8 E)
        probability for CAT 1 or above is 10% in about 48 hours
        probability for TS is 55% in about 72 hours
    Gascoyne Junction (25.1 S, 115.2 E)
        probability for CAT 1 or above is 10% in about 72 hours
        probability for TS is 55% in about 72 hours
    Useless Loop (26.3 S, 113.4 E)
        probability for CAT 1 or above is 10% in about 72 hours
        probability for TS is 35% in about 72 hours

Note that
    Yellow Alert (Elevated) is CAT 1 or above to between 10% and 30% probability, or TS to above 50% probability.
    CAT 1 means Tropical Cyclone strength winds of at least 74 mph, 119 km/h or 64 knots 1-min sustained.
    TS means Tropical Storm strength winds of at least 39 mph, 63 km/h or 34 knots 1-min sustained.
